Job Details

Caroline Ansell, Member of Parliament for Eastbourne & Willingdon, is looking to appoint a Parliamentary Assistant to join her Westminster office, working alongside a dedicated constituency team based in sunny Eastbourne.
 
The successful applicant will be an excellent communicator with strong IT, administrative and organisational skills. They will be able to demonstrate a knowledge of the key issues concerning people in Eastbourne & Willingdon and an understanding of the town and area. Previous political experience is essential, and previous experience in Westminster, is highly desirable. Ideally, we are looking to appoint for July.
 
Main Duties include:
  •  Prepare and present briefing notes for committees, press releases, parliamentary questions etc
  •  Accompany the MP to meetings and follow up on agreed actions as appropriate
  •  Diary Management
  •  Develop and maintain current knowledge of bills, Early Day Motions, legislation, Hansard, debates etc and how they relate to the MP’s constituency
  •  Respond to routine correspondence and enquiries
  •  Ensure the MP is fully briefed on potential questions and motions to be put to the House
  •  Monitor media coverage and brief the Member on relevant issues
  •  Analyse, evaluate and interpret data to ensure Member is accurately informed on key issues
  • Progress casework as required
  • Provide generalist admin support
  • Undertake research in support of the MP’s work
